Protesters March Against Bullfighting’s Return to Mexico
It’s a fight against fighting. People took to the streets in Mexico City to protest the centuries old practice of bullfighting. It’s a battle these activists hoped was over in 2022 when a court ruling reportedly stopped bullfighting as a precursor to a greater court’s ruling. Late last year, Mexico’s supreme court overturned that ruling and the sport started up again. Inside Edition Digital’s Mara Montalbano has more.
